Tony Kranz moved to Encinitas, California, as a baby in 1960 and spent his youth involved in sports and the graphic arts and enjoying the beautiful Pacific Ocean shoreline. He graduated from San Dieguito High School in 1977 and attended college at Palomar and Cal Poly in San Luis Obispo.

Following college, Tony moved to Anchorage, Alaska, and served as an air traffic controller in the Army National Guard. He also spent seven years living in St. Louis Park, Minnesota.

In 1985, Tony married his wife Cynthia, another long-time Encinitas resident. They have three children: James, Brian and Stephanie. Tony still enjoys sports as a life-long fan of the Padres and continues his work in the graphic arts with photography and printing sales.

Tony was elected to the Encinitas City Council in 2012 and is working to promote policies that help to protect our natural resources, improve our quality of life and address social justice issues.
